Epcot Food and Wine Fest: Favorite Foods so Far this Year

So, what's everybody loving at F&W so far this year? I've only been a couple of times so far (Wine and Dine after party doesn't count since I was nauseous Smile ) . Both have been short trips where I only got to taste a couple of things, and I have almost no pics (I keep eating before I remember to snap. Gah!) But so far, I am loving the Kahlua Pork slider from Hawaii, and the Tuna Poke gets a MaJOR thumbs up! The scallop and lobster fisherman's pie from Ireland is wonderful, too - I had a pretty big piece of lobster meat in mine. But hands down, so far this year my ab favorite has been the Greek griddled cheese with honey and pistachios! Salty sweet fabulous yum! I will be having this again and again and again.
